Abstrak

Chinese betel leaf known by the Latin name Peperomia pellucida L. is one of the plants that has secondary metabolite compounds that can act as medicinal ingredients that are efficacious to inhibit the growth of bacteria that cause infection. This study aims to determine the antibacterial effectiveness of Chinese betel leaves taken in Aimas, Sorong Regency, Southwest Papua. The bacteria used in this study are Staphylococcus aureus and Escherichia coli bacteria. maceration and sohxletasi with extract concentrations of 12.5%, 25%, 50%. The results showed that Chinese siri leaves at extract concentrations with the maceration method showed effectiveness on S.aureus bacteria with inhibition zones formed at a concentration of 12.5% with a diameter of 5.83 mm, 25% with a diameter of 10 mm, and 50% with a diameter of 12.83 mm. Pada bakteri E. coli ketiga konsentrasi terbentuk zona hambat masing-masing 4,75 mm, 6 mm, 10,83 mm. In contrast to the results of the ethanol extract of Chinese siri leaves with the soxhletation method did not show any inhibition zone on S. aureus and E. coli bacteria. The conclusion in this study is that extra ethanol of Chinese siri leaves using the maceration method has effectiveness against Staphylococcus aureus and Eschericia coli bacteria.
